Choose the correct Liverpool pickup point

Liverpool city centre

If you are staying in a hotel, apartment or office in central Liverpool, use the complete address when booking. Some city-centre locations have restricted access, pedestrianised sections or limited stopping space, so a precise address helps the driver plan a suitable collection point.

Liverpool Lime Street

Lime Street may be convenient if your journey to Liverpool begins by train, but it is different from Liverpool John Lennon Airport and Liverpool South Parkway. Give the station name and any relevant entrance or meeting instructions when arranging collection.

Liverpool South Parkway

South Parkway is an important interchange for rail and bus connections to Liverpool John Lennon Airport. If you are meeting a vehicle there, confirm the exact pickup instructions in advance, particularly if you are travelling with several passengers or large luggage.

Liverpool John Lennon Airport

Liverpool John Lennon Airport is at Liverpool L24 1YD. Its official access information refers to road connections through Speke Boulevard, also known as the A561, and Speke Hall Avenue, with links to the M56, M57, M62 and M6 motorway network.

However, the approved origin for this route is simply Liverpool. Do not assume that a booking starts at Liverpool John Lennon Airport unless airport pickup has specifically been requested. An airport-to-airport journey may require different meeting arrangements from a collection at a Liverpool home, hotel or railway station.

Planning the journey to Exeter Airport

Exeter Airport’s official postcode is EX5 2BD. The airport states that it is approximately five miles from Exeter city centre and around five minutes from the M5 motorway. These local access details do not create a universal journey time from Liverpool, but they can help with the final destination information provided to your driver.

For a Liverpool pickup, allow time for the full road journey as well as airport arrival, terminal access, luggage drop-off and any other requirements for your flight. The correct departure time will depend on your airline’s instructions, the date and time of travel, your pickup location, traffic conditions and whether you need a break.

Public transport alternatives

Public transport can be considered if you are comfortable managing changes and checking live timetables. Merseytravel lists bus services linking Liverpool city centre, Liverpool South Parkway and Liverpool John Lennon Airport, but routes and operating times vary by service and day. These services are useful for reaching Liverpool airport or another transport interchange; they are not a direct Liverpool-to-Exeter Airport transfer.

Rail travel can take you towards Exeter, but Exeter Airport is not directly served by a railway station. Exeter Airport states that Stagecoach service 4A connects the airport with Exeter St Davids Station, while service 43 connects the airport with Pinhoe rail station. Its travel information also explains that connections can be made from Exeter St Davids or Exeter Central using service 4A.

National Rail provides journey-planning information for travel from Liverpool Central to Exeter Central, but Exeter Central is in the city and is not Exeter Airport. You would need an onward bus or taxi connection, with extra time for changing, waiting and handling luggage.

Check live operator information for your travel date before relying on a specific bus departure, rail connection, fare or frequency. Services and timetables can change, and a connection that works during the day may not be available for an early-morning or late-evening flight.

Private transfer or public transport: which is better?

A private transfer is often most suitable when you want a single pre-arranged road journey, are travelling with several bags or need to coordinate a group. It can also reduce the number of changes involved at each end of the trip.

Public transport may be worth considering if you are travelling alone with light luggage, have flexible timing and are happy to plan a rail journey followed by an Exeter-area bus or taxi. Compare the complete journey rather than only the train fare: include travel to the first station, changes, waiting time, onward transport and the practical effort of moving luggage.

At Exeter Airport, the airport identifies Apple Taxis Exeter as the only officially authorised private-hire company operating from the Arrivals taxi desk and adjacent taxi stands. Other taxi companies must use Car Park 1 for pre-booked pickups or drop-offs. This information mainly applies to journeys starting or ending at the airport with local taxi arrangements; a pre-booked Liverpool operator should provide its own collection and drop-off instructions.
